随着TypeScript性能的提升,JsDoc爱好者的主要抱怨几乎被消除。人们开始思考是否继续使用JsDoc,还是转向TypeScript。
JSDoc是一种文档标准,允许开发者为JavaScript代码添加结构化注释,描述功能、参数类型和返回值,提升代码可读性和类型安全,便于团队协作。它可生成HTML文档,增强IDE体验,适用于JavaScript和TypeScript项目。
在遗留代码中,jsDoc可以替代TypeScript,因为它无需编译且不干扰现有代码。jsDoc与TypeScript兼容,便于在两者间灵活使用,简化开发过程,方便在不同环境中查看和重用代码。
TypeScript和JSDoc为JavaScript提供静态类型,能减少错误、提高开发效率,避免测试和文档过时。尽管TypeScript的构建步骤较复杂,但其优势明显,受到开发者青睐。静态类型工具对开发者和项目均有积极影响。
这篇文章介绍了Remotion内部包ai-improvements的用途,该包用于改进/生成Remotion源代码中函数的JSDoc注释和控制台日志。该包使用OpenAI API根据API文档和源代码生成函数的JSDoc注释。文章还提到了如何配置该包以及如何使用openai API生成JSDoc注释。文章最后提到了ts-morph库可以用于操作源代码的AST级别。
在几乎Typescript已经成功统治前端领域的今天,做为前端人,你是已经习惯了Typescript的类型声明,还是依旧对Typescript怀抱抵触心理?而且网络上各种“去Typescipt”的言论和行动此起彼伏,从来都没有断绝的意思。 不过我也相信很多人在使用一段时间Typescript以后,都会产生一个疑问:Typescript到底给我带来了什么好处?
前言 俗话说,无规矩不成方圆;虽说代码敲出来都是交给编译器解释执行的,只要不存在语法格式错误,排版无论多么反人类都是没有问题的,但是代码除了执行外的另一个广泛用途就是阅读了,翻阅自己过去的代码、理解别人的源码,等等;所以出现了代码风格化,美化外观的同时便于阅读,这就是目前 JSLint...
完成下面两步后,将自动完成登录并继续当前操作。